1997 SESSION
SB 1013 Public service companies; rights-of-way.
Introduced by: Richard J. Holland |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Y:
Public service companies; rights-of-way. Stipulates that franchise, permit and inspection fees charged telecommunications companies by localities and the Commonwealth Transportation Board for the use of public rights-of-way or easements may not exceed those in effect on February 1, 1997. The bill also prohibits localities and the Board from requiring in-kind services or physical assets as (i) a condition of consent to a telecommunication company's use of public property, public rights-of-way or easements or (ii) a substitute for any fees. The bill's provisions are subject to an emergency clause, making them effective upon passage. The bill also has a sunset clause; its provisions will expire on July 1, 1998.
